Sulphonic

Webster's Dictionary of the English Language

·adj Pertaining to, or derived from, a sulphone;

— used specifically to designate any one of a series of acids (regarded as acid ethereal salts of sulphurous acid) obtained by the oxidation of the mercaptans, or by treating sulphuric acid with certain aromatic bases (as benzene); as, phenyl sulphonic acid, C6H5·SO2·OH, a stable colorless crystalline substance.
